Astronomical seasons are defined by the Earth's position relative to the sun. These seasons start on specific dates known as equinoxes and solstices, which can vary by a day or two each year: Starts ~March 20 (Equinox) Summer: Starts ~June 21 (Solstice) Autumn: Starts ~September 22 (Equinox) Winter: Starts ~December 21 (Solstice) Tropical and Polar Exceptions seasons what months

Near the equator, temperatures remain warm year-round. Instead of four seasons, these areas usually have two: the Wet Season and the Dry Season .
